我想按以下方式处理登录场景:
客户端连接到无状态Java ( SLJB )并尝试登录;如果登录成功,SLJB将向用户返回一个状态Java (SFJB),以便客户机能够继续使用该应用程序。
我目前正在做的第二步是:
return new StatefulBean(some params);
这样做对吗?在我看来,这并不是一个例外:
Class org.eclipse.persistence.internal.jpa.EntityManagerImpl is not Serializable
在运行我的应用程序时,我认为它与所描述的方法有关。
从SLJB向客户端返回对SFJB的引用的正确方法是什么
我们在应用程序中使用WSO2 IS 5.2.0进行用户身份验证和单点登录。我们有多个基于java技术的web应用程序。所有的应用程序都在WSO2服务提供商注册,我们能够成功地认证用户,并能够做单点登录。当用户第一次尝试访问其中一个应用程序时,系统会提示用户登录。一旦用户登录,他就可以访问任何应用程序。我们正在使用HTTP重定向来实现这一点。在应用程序端,我们使用WSO2 java API (org.wso2.cion.identity ty.sso.* package)来获取经过身份验证的用户详细信息和声明信息。
现在我们在.Net中又多了一个应用程序,我们希望将其集成到我们的应用程序套件中,
我使用JAX在Java中创建了一个非常简单的REST JAX服务。并让客户端对该get服务进行Ajax调用,以登录并获取登录信息。
JAX-RS码
@Path("/netsuite")
public class myRESTWebService{
@GET
@Path("/login/{userName}")
public String login(@PathParam("userName") String userName){
//here I have to save that userName in some
在让IE8与OpenAM一起工作时,我遇到了麻烦。我正在使用一个定制的登录模块,它是一个扩展com.sun.identity.authentication.spi.AMLoginModule.的java类我的登录模块在火狐、chrome和最新版本的IE上都能很好地工作,但IE8让它不能正常工作。
登录模块分为两个步骤:首先提示输入用户名和密码,然后提示输入验证码。身份验证过程的两个步骤基于进程状态。因此,我的process()方法可以总结为:
public int process(Callback[] callbacks, int state) throws AuthLoginExceptio